How can I be part of Tech@Tyson?
The Sr. Manager of IT Security Governance, Risk, & Compliance provides leadership and direction in support of global security GRC programs and directs operations and services within their organization to ensure that Tyson technology assets and risks align to the greater business and technology strategy.
You will also be responsible for:
- Providing input to the security strategy and roadmap and partnership with architecture and other IT governance functions, the position is hands-on and requires tactical management of security GRC processes, frameworks, and tools. The position requires knowledge of security and IT frameworks and best practices (e.g. NIST, CIS, ITIL, COBIT, CMM) and regulations (e.g. HIPAA, GDPR) applicable to fortune-100 multi-national organizations
- Partnering with internal stakeholders to facilitate 3rd party and supply chain risk programs, security training and awareness, IT policy governance, privacy compliance, customer and regulatory security audits and assessments, governance process interlocks, long-term strategy planning, security program roadmaps, certification & accreditation, and program metrics and reporting
- Consulting and advising stakeholders on tools, processes, and governance to manage risk and protect and ensure safety of the company technology operations. (e.g. privilege management, security configuration compliance validation tools, cloud security operations, access control, network security, enforcement policy scripting, workload security, and data security)
- Providing insights and recommendations of technology and security risks and solutions that will ensure that all operations and tasks are conducted and assist in technical support to monitor, mitigate, manage, and track security incidents

Education: Minimum 4-year degree (or equivalent experience) in computer science, engineering, information systems, cybersecurity, accounting\audit, or other related discipline.
Experience:
Required Skills/qualifications:
- Excellent verbal and written communication skills
- Ability to react to high pressure dynamic changing environments
- Strong analytical and problem-solving skills and the ability to "think-out-of-the-box”
- Has led the development or management of a Security Risk Management, Policy Management, and Governance program
Preferred Qualifications:
- 7-10+ years IT security or information security experience with a proven ability to engage with senior management, regulators, and customers
- 4+ years experience conducting IT compliance assessments (Sarbanes-Oxley, PCI, HIPAA, CMMC, etc.)
- 4+ years experience in administering IT security controls in an organization.
- Knowledge of technical infrastructure, networks, databases and systems in relation to IT Security and IT Risk
- Advanced Information Security or Audit related certification (e.g. CRISC, CISSP, CISM, CISA)
